Prerequisite: Intro to Prong Setting
Building on the fundamentals of prong setting, this advanced workshop focuses on the precision and finesse required for setting faceted stones in solitaire-style mountings. You'll refine techniques like seat cutting, stone alignment, and secure finishing.
Ideal for those with basic prong setting experience, this class will significantly elevate your stone setting capabilities and open up new possibilities for fine jewelry design.
The kit fee is $ 25 and is in addition to the tuition to be paid to the Instructor. It includes: 2 rings, one 6 prong and one 4 prong to be completed in class.
MATERIALS & TOOLS
Bring your Metalsmithing toolbox, including the following items:
- Chain Nose Pliers (Rio Grande #111074, or Otto Frie #146.606)
- Prong Setting Pliers (Otto Frei #146.346)
- 5.0mm Setting Bur (Rio Grande Item No. 341559 pack of 6 or OttoFrei $8.90 single)
